Convert Your CV to a Resume

Industry resumes are not condensed CVs. They are different documents with a different purpose. UCR’s Convert-CV-to-Resume guide walks through what to keep, what to drop, and how to translate academic accomplishments into business language.

  • Trim publications to the top three relevant to the role.
  • Lead each bullet with an action verb and a quantifiable outcome.
  • Use the language from the job description in your skills line.
  • One page for early career, two pages maximum for senior PhD roles.

Good to know

Bring three versions of your document to review: the position description, the role-tailored draft, and a “skeleton” version with the same content but no role-specific phrasing. The Career Specialist can quickly show you what’s missing.
